We are about to finish this tutorial, now we need to add some finishing touches to enhance our image. First we will add reflection to the eyes to give it natural look. For this, create a white ellipse on eye pupil then add a vector mask to the layer and mask lower part of white ellipse by a soft brush of size 50 pixels.
